Queensway Area 'Under Fire'

Prince George RCMP are investigating at least five complaints from citizens who were shot at with either pellets or small ball bearings from a slingshot in the past three days, along Queensway.

One call involved a young female being shot at as she was walking near the Gospel Chapel in the 15-hundred block of the street.  Police say the wall of the building was hit at least eight times. 

That incident occurred on Saturday, since then there have been four complaints from the drivers of vehicle who were travelling along Queensway when their windows were shot out.

Staff-Sergeant Doug Aird says police have been conducting surveillance in the area and have spoke to a resident in the Queensway Tower Apartments. 

Aird says, although the suspect hasn't been arrested, it's believed the suspect just recently purchased the slingshot and metal pellets at a local hardware or sporting goods store.  He's inviting anyone with information to call the local detachment and says officers continue to follow up on leads.
